Family Friends Eager For Palin’s Speech To GOP
COEUR D’ALENE – When Sarah Palin takes center stage at the GOP convention in St. Paul Wednesday she’ll be cheered on by some close family friends in Coeur d’Alene.
Jack and Zella Bloxom’s kitchen table is covered with newspaper clippings following Sarah Palin’s political career from governor to vice presidential nominee for the Republican Party.
Jack went to Sandpoint High School with Sarah’s dad Chuck and the two families have stayed close over the years, constantly sending each other family updates which have included a book about Sarah’s rise from small town mayor to governor of Alaska and an article from Vogue magazine.
Zella learned about the nomination from a friend the day it was announced and the couple called Sarah’s parents in Alaska.
“I think we need someone like Sarah in there,” Zella said. “I think we need someone to straighten things up, clean up government and really go to work for the country and people.”
“It doesn’t matter what the obstacle is like she will conquer it,” Jack said.
When Palin addresses the nation Wednesday night there’s no question where Jack and Zella will be.
“Well, I’m going to be listening to Sarah that’s for sure,” Jack said.
“I’ll be watching TV too. I really want to hear her speech, maybe get a glimpse of the rest of her family,” Zella said.
After all, it’s not everyday you can say you know a vice presidential nominee.
“Not ever before, I’ve never been this close and so it’s exciting and it’s fun,” Zella said.
